Transaction 21af4104f4e73e4c2ec52ae68323676e03dfe98dceffb68b311ba42e5d026684

1 Input
2 Outputs
  • 21af4104f4e73e4c2ec52ae68323676e03dfe98dceffb68b311ba42e5d026684:0
  • value  3248300
    address  3NyXKDo9gzEz4b5ypHcTRG2gD4j5TpQwCv
  • 21af4104f4e73e4c2ec52ae68323676e03dfe98dceffb68b311ba42e5d026684:1
  • value  11450345
    address  37V2EEtVCedmYptCeYitnoYtUqm1AK2e65